Lost Resurrected: The End
And in the end, a good number of people were left disappointed with “The End.” They wanted confirmation that the polar bear came from Tunisia through the donkey wheel, instead of just putting 2 and 2 together (making 4, of course). They wanted to know why Dharma left at least one care package long after their involvement on the island had ended. They wanted to know why Sawyer’s hair was short in the original plane crash but was suddenly long in all of the flashbacks of it. For the viewers that thought they had been watching a better version of a science-fiction show like The X Files and ended up viewing a character study that happened to have science-fiction in it, the ending made them feel like they were suckered into watching Touched by an Angel. Yeah, that would make me a little angry too. Read more…

This Week In Television: May 15-21, 2010
All of the major networks released their 2010 fall schedules. Click on this sentence to see the entire fall lineup thanks to TV Guide.
CBS axed a lot of mediocre programs that got mediocre ratings, namely Cold Case, The Ghost Whisperer and The New Adventures of Old Christine. They also decided to pit The Big Bang Theory up against Community Thursdays at 8 EST. CBS also is putting the Shit My Dad Says Show on against 30 Rock.
NBC wont be bringing back Parks and Recreation until mid-season, just to make sure they make a stupid decision that shows they don’t respect quality once every two months. Read more…
